Bhurkunda is a Rural village located in Goghat-ii, Hooghly, West-bengal.

The total population of Bhurkunda is 2,361.

Bhurkunda village comprises 564 households.

The literacy rate in Bhurkunda is 75.6%. Among the literate population of 1,595, there are 887 literate males and 708 literate females.

In Bhurkunda, there are 1,218 males and 1,143 females, with a sex ratio of 938 females per 1000 males.

There are 252 children (10.7% of population), comprising 139 boys and 113 girls.

The total number of workers in Bhurkunda is 914, with 583 main workers and 331 marginal workers.

In Bhurkunda, there are 947 people belonging to Scheduled Castes (504 males, 443 females) and 180 people belonging to Scheduled Tribes (92 males, 88 females).

Bhurkunda is located in West-bengal state, Hooghly district, and falls under Goghat-ii Tehsil. The village's Census 2011 code is 324126 and LGD code is 324126.
